Learning Technology Developer (Part-Time)
Job Description
We are looking for a part-time (17.5 hours) developer in
learning technology applications to work with the SELLIC
Project (Science & Engineering Library, Learning & Information
Centre) on applications for teaching Science and Engineering. A
sound technical background and considerable experience of the
languages and packages widely used in developing stand-alone
and online learning and teaching applications for use in Higher
Education are essential. The developer will work closely with
SELLIC's Learning Technology Officer to select and develop
applications for use in teaching within the Faculty. The post is
fixed term for 12 months. Salary scale £8,726 - £9,743pa
